Robotic Surgery Enhances Precision, Recovery In Pancreatic Treatment - Specialist

By Rozainah Abdul Rahim

SUBANG JAYA, July 29 (Bernama) -- Advances in robotic-assisted surgery are transforming the treatment of pancreatic diseases, offering patients greater precision, fewer complications and faster recovery.

Hepatobiliary and Pancreatic Surgery, and Robotic Surgery Specialist at Sunway Medical Centre, Sunway City (SMC), Dr Bong Jan Jin said pancreatic surgery, once associated with large incisions and prolonged hospital stays, has evolved significantly with the adoption of minimally invasive and robotic techniques.

“Pancreatic surgery involves removing part of the pancreas, a deep organ located behind the stomach. Because of its position and proximity to major blood vessels, it is considered highly complex and requires specialised skill,” he told Bernama in an exclusive interview recently.

Dr Bong said surgery is commonly indicated for malignant and benign tumours, chronic inflammation such as pancreatitis and accident traumatic injuries to the pancreas.

Among the common procedures is distal pancreatectomy, which involves removal of the body and tail of the pancreas. In certain cases, the spleen may also need to be removed, although surgeons aim to preserve it whenever possible due to its role in immune function.

“The spleen is one of the few organs that controls the immune function of the body, playing a key role in the natural defence against external bacterial threats.

“Without the spleen, either surgically removed or removed because of trauma or disease, patients are exposed to certain risks of infection,” he said.

He noted that traditional open surgery requires a large abdominal incision, which may result in significant postoperative pain, higher risk of wound infection and longer recovery time.

“The latest development is that we are moving into robotic surgery. With robotic surgery, surgeons operate through small incisions using robotic arms controlled from a console.

“The system provides a magnified three-dimensional projection of the internal organs through a camera, and surgeons control the robotic arms. This robotic arms has got a lot of degree of movement, mimicking natural human wrist, allowing better precision in such a tight space.

According to Dr Bong, patients undergoing robotic pancreatic surgery generally experience less pain, reduced reliance on strong painkillers and quicker return of bowel function compared to conventional surgery.

“Robotic surgery usually allows faster recovery, enabling patients to be mobile sooner.  If no complication, patients may be discharged within seven to 10 days, and resume daily activities sooner,” he said.

On patient eligibility, Dr Bong said suitability for robotic or laparoscopic surgery depends on tumour’s location, size and whether major blood vessels are involved.

He also highlighted the growing practice of administering chemotherapy before surgery for selected pancreatic cancer patients.

“Neoadjuvant chemotherapy helps shrink the tumour and increases the likelihood of complete removal. This approach has been associated with improved long-term outcomes in appropriate cases,” he said.

Addressing common patient concerns, Dr Bong said many patients are worried about the risk of developing diabetes after pancreatic surgery.

“In the case of distal pancreatectomy, it depends on whether you are pre-diabetic to begin with, or normal person, or already diabetic. If you are already a diabetic, then the diabetic medication dose or the insulin will also need to increase. If the insulin demand is increased, your diabetes may temporarily worsen.

“If you are a normal person without history of diabetes, then it is very unlikely you will become diabetic because once the patient lost 50 per cent (of the pancreas), the other 50 per cent can still cope with the secretion of insulin and the enzymes,” he explained.

He also advised patients to adopt small, frequent meals and a high-protein, low-fat and less sugar diet in the early postoperative period to support recovery.

“This will allow the body to adjust to the new norm where the pancreas needs to adapt and compensate for loss of 50 per cent, and they can compensate and adjust to the new norm. Usually, with some dietary advice and teaching, we can usually achieve this quite successfully.

Dr Bong said that in the long run, most patients recover fully after robotic surgery, with only four tiny abdominal incisions as visible signs.
